The Future of House of Hope

With the help of many volunteers and very generous suppliers, the students of House of Hope have completed the renovation of their temporary housing in Wildwood. We are so grateful to the Pastors and members of Wildwood Methodist Church for allowing us to live in this beautiful home until God leads us to our permanent location.

 

See the location and facility plans for our new facility

Earlier this spring, an opportunity was given to House of Hope by the Helping Hands/Bargains and Blessings ministry for a $50,000 match grant for funds raised from churches. Today we are pleased to share that this match grant has now reached its goal. We thank Helping Hands for their support and give all praise and honor to God.

We are also grateful that a second match grant is now being offered by our Board of Directors. Any donation sent to the ministry and earmarked for the building fund/capital campaign will be matched up to $25,000.

The program continues and, through their faith in Christ, our students are working diligently to overcome their addictions and return to their families as faith-filled and productive members of our community.
